Emily Kwan Bo-Wai (born February 23, 1966) is a Hong Kong film, television, and stage actress. She was formerly affiliated with TVB (Television Broadcasts Limited) and HKTV (Hong Kong Television Network). Known for her frequent appearances in low-budget horror and comedy films, Emily has also starred in a number of Hong Kong Category III films. One of her most recognized roles was as Mu Nianci, the second female lead in the TV adaptation of The Legend of the Condor Heroes, a performance that earned her praise from audiences for her acting skills.
